Foxconn, a major player in manufacturing and technology, is at the center of this analysis. The company's moves and patenting strategies are crucial indicators of upcoming trends and shifts in the telecom sector.
Foxconn's patent portfolio spans a wide range of technologies. For instance, the company has patented advanced techniques for wafer fabrication in semiconductor manufacturing, incorporating AI-driven systems to monitor and adjust the production process in real time.
This innovation significantly reduces defects during production and positions Foxconn as a critical player in the technology supply chain.
In the telecommunications sector, Foxconn has also patented differential signal electrical connectors with grounding contacts extending from shielding plates, which enhance signal integrity and reduce interference.

The Innovation and Drafting Dilemma 📝
The quality of a patent application hinges on the expertise of its drafting. In many cases, especially in academic circles and certain companies, the drafting process is outsourced to the cheapest available vendors. This cost-cutting measure often results in subpar applications that fail to capture the true essence and value of the innovation.
The language and technical details become muddled, weakening the patent's strength and effectiveness. This is a critical area where improvement can significantly enhance the value and impact of intellectual property.

India's Intellectual Property Crossroads 🇮🇳💡
India stands at a crucial juncture in its understanding and application of intellectual property rights. With a wealth of research and datasets at its disposal, India needs to adopt a more diligent and strategic approach.
This includes reevaluating how patents are filed and utilized, ensuring that they serve as tools for innovation and growth rather than mere formalities. India's potential to emerge as a leader in telecommunications hinges on its ability to navigate these intellectual property challenges effectively.
India has been making progress in the intellectual property landscape. For example, the country has been focusing on strengthening its patent laws and promoting innovation. However, challenges remain in terms of patent quality, enforcement, and awareness.
